Should or Must
Can you help me to understand those words?
Which one is more *strong* ? (hmmm , I don't know how to say)
>>>I should work now
>>>I must work now
what is the difference between them?

"Must" is used for something that is either
a) compulsory
b) important or vital
c) a logical conclusion
or d) something you highly recommend
"Should" is used for something that is:
a) right or correct (a duty or obligation)
b) advice or a suggestion
c) something that is likely to happen
"Must" is stronger, and more emphatic. "Should" is not used for something compulsory, although it is for an obligation.
"Should" is more commonly used for "I should work now". But either can be used.
